#include "../machine.h"
typedef char integer1;
typedef short integer2;
/* Copyright INRIA */
#define BIT(Type,Op) {\
Type *DX;\
Type *DY;\
DX=(Type *)dx;\
--DX;\
DY=(Type *)dy;\
--DY;\
if (*incx == 1 && *incy == 1)\
for (i = 1; i <= nv; ++i) \
DY[i] = DX[i] Op DY[i];\
else {\
ix = 1; iy = 1;\
if (*incx < 0) ix = (-nv + 1) * *incx + 1;\
if (*incy < 0) iy = (-nv + 1) * *incy + 1;\
for (i = 1; i <= nv; ++i) {\
DY[iy] = DX[ix] Op DY[iy];\
ix += *incx; iy += *incy;\
}\
}\
}
int C2F(genbitops)(typ,op, n, dx, incx, dy, incy)
integer *n;
integer *incx;
integer *incy;
integer *typ;
integer *op;
int *dx;
int *dy;
{
static integer i, ix, iy, nv;
nv=*n;
if (nv <= 0) return 0;
switch (*op) {
case 57:
switch (*typ) {
case 1:
BIT(integer1,|);
break;
case 2:
BIT(integer2,|);
break;
case 4:
BIT(integer,|);
break;
case 11:
BIT(unsigned char,|);
break;
case 12:
BIT(unsigned short,|);
break;
case 14:
BIT(unsigned int,|);
break;
}
break;
case 58:
switch (*typ) {
case 1:
BIT(integer1,&);
break;
case 2:
BIT(integer2,&);
break;
case 4:
BIT(integer,&);
break;
case 11:
BIT(unsigned char,&);
break;
case 12:
BIT(unsigned short,&);
break;
case 14:
BIT(unsigned int,&);
break;
}
break;
}
}
